Firstly, let's understand what Binance is and what Nano is.
Binance is a global cryptocurrency exchange that was launched in 2017. It is known for its user-friendly interface, high liquidity, and a wide range of trading pairs. Binance has become a go-to platform for both beginners and experienced traders looking to trade cryptocurrencies.
Nano (NANO) is a decentralized cryptocurrency that aims to provide fast, secure, and feeless transactions. It utilizes a unique consensus mechanism called block-lattice, which allows for instant transactions and low fees.
